Elie '20, Petitbon '20, Matan '20, and Waller Earn Pigskin Awards

The Pigskin Club of Washington held its 80th Annual Awards Banquet on February 28 at Catholic University. The Pigskin Club was founded in 1938 with goals of promoting the benefits of sports and fair play and bringing together those associated with the game who share those goals. The club selects an All-Met Football Team, but also recognizes student-athletes and coaches of the year in a number of other sports. Additionally, academic achievement is recognized.

Three Gonzaga student-athletes earned awards for their excellent play on the field and also for their hard work in the classroom. Senior Ryan Elie was named the Soccer Player of the Year, while seniors Patrick Matan and Luke Petitbon were named to the All-Met Football Team. All three Eagles were also given the Scholar Athlete Award for meeting the required GPA. Coach Scott Waller was named the Soccer Coach of the Year.
